41Hawthorn Renesme Geo Cube Jersey Wrap Dress - $78
When I first saw this in the box, I thought "no way." I am not a pink person and I definitely tend to go towards more subtle patterns. But Looking at the top of this dress, I really liked how it looked on..but there was one small problem.
The material was VERY clingy and did nothing to hide my midsection - in fact, it emphasized it. A big no-no in my closet! So this was definitely a return. I did consider exchanging for a size up, but the fit wasn't the issue - the material would always be clingy regardless of size.
Brixon Ivy Embroidered Cutout Blouse - $64
I'm usually not a yellow person, but I loved the fit of this top! It gave me a shape without clinging and it's light and fun. I was presently surprised to love this top!
How cute are the cutouts on the sleeves? Even though the price was a little more then I usually spend on a blouse, I felt it was worth it. Definitely something I can wear often. Light enough for summer with a pair of shorts or skirt, but still wearable in the winter with a cardigan. Keep, for sure.
Skies Are Blue Pocket Flare Skirt - $58
I'm not going to lie, as soon as I saw this I swooned a bit. Audrey Hepburn is my style icon, and this just screamed Roman Holiday. I loved it. I even liked the way it fit with the tucked in blouse - something I usually avoid. It was so light and comfortable. But then I took a look at my legs. It was just a few inches too long to be a good fit. Unless I wore heels often, which I do not, it made my muscular legs look chubby and short. So I regrettably decided to return it.
